How does Prescott, AR compare to Corning, AR? Prescott has a population of 3,063 with a median household income of $29,403, while Corning has 3,169 residents and a median income of $44,197.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Prescott, AR | Corning, AR |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 3,063 | 3,169 | -3.3% |
| Median Age | 35.4 | 39.7 | -10.8% |
| Foreign Born % | 0.2% | 1.1% | -81.8% |
| Metric | Prescott | Corning |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$29,403 | $44,197 | -33.5% |
| Unemployment | 4.1% | 4.7% | -12.8% |
| Poverty Rate | 34.1% | 17.5% | +94.9% |
| Bachelor's+ | 11.4% | 20.8% | -45.2% |
| Metric | Prescott | Corning |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$95,100 | $85,800 | +10.8% |
| Median Rent | $863/mo | $713/mo | +21.0% |
| Housing Units | 1,497 | 1,642 | -8.8% |
